Most farmers rely on nylon rope knots (which degrade and break in 3 months of saltwater exposure) or galvanized iron clips (prone to rust jamming, making repeated use impossible). This leads to devastating issues: HDPE oyster mesh bags tear at seams, cylinder tumbler splices split, and up to 8-12% of oyster seeds escape. Replacing these faulty connectors monthly adds unnecessary labor and material costs.
Our 316 Stainless Steel Oyster Bag Shark Clip (3*110mm) eliminates these risks with targeted design:
Anti-Slip Bite Teeth: 5mm-deep, 2mm-spaced teeth grip 1-5mm thick HDPE mesh (the material of our HDPE Oyster Grow Bag and Cylinder Oyster Tumblers) tightly—even after years of seawater immersion, no slippage occurs.
Anti-Jam Spring Technology: The clip’s spring uses a precision winding process that resists saltwater corrosion. It maintains stable clamping force even after 1,000 openings and closings, with a 95%+ reuse rate (vs. 0% for rusted iron clips).

Pain Point 3: Poor Compatibility—Multiple Connectors for Multiple Gear
The Problem
Oyster farms rarely use just one type of gear: HDPE Oyster Mesh Bags(1-2mm thick) for seeding, Cylinder Oyster Tumblers (3-5mm thick) for grow-out, and Hexagonal Oyster Basket (4mm thick) for harvesting. Traditional setups require 3+ different connectors, leading to overstock, storage chaos, and last-minute runs to replace missing parts—especially for small-to-medium farms.
The Shark Clip Solution
Our 316 Stainless Steel Shark Clip (3*110mm) is a “one-clip-fits-all” solution:
Wide Clamping Range: Adapts to 1-5mm thick materials, perfectly fitting all three core gear types.
Universal Design: Works for sealing mesh bag tops, splicing cylinder tumblers, and securing baskets to rafts—no need for specialized clips.
The Value
Farms eliminate 60% of connector inventory, cut storage costs, and avoid downtime from missing parts. Small operations, in particular, benefit from simplified purchasing (one clip for all gear) and easier inventory management.
